With compassion, a mother cat nurtures and revives ailing kitten.

December 15, 2023 by Nhat Anh

With immense compassion, a young mother cat diligently cares for a ailing kitten, restoring his zest for life and nurturing him back to health.

Bowie, an abandoned kitten, arrived at a shelter shortly after Dottie, a mother taken in with her 5 little ones. While Bowie’s health was poor, a solution was attempted to get him back on the right path and allow him to regain his strength.

First it was Dottie , a cat with a white coat and a spotted face, who arrived at Shelbi Uyehara ‘s home on. Jin’s Bottle Babies , located in Arizona (United States). Not very comfortable with humans, she took time to get her bearings and to trust the volunteers. Arriving with her tribe of 5 kittens, she still seemed at ease helping her whole little world grow up, away from the dangers of the street.

A little after Dottie , a little ginger cat arrived in the home. Also rescued from the street, this very young kitten was orphaned. Starving, the cat’s condition worried the members of the household who rushed to find a solution to help the feline. Found in a dumpster , the kitten came close to death and could have suffered serious after-effects from this traumatic start to life. Love Meow shared the story of these 2 joint stories.

Bowie: a kitten in great danger

Upon his arrival at Shelbi ‘s home , Bowie , this little ginger kitten, was taken care of and bottle-fed. Without a mother to raise him and meet his most basic needs, it was necessary to feed and pamper him, more than any other kitten. Having a significant delay in growth, the cat was unable to open its eyes and remained prostrate.

To help the kitten, a proposal was made: entrust Bowie to a mother cat. Volunteers quickly found the ideal cat in Dottie , the young mother of 5 kittens.

“She immediately became attached to him”

It was with a little trepidation that the volunteers entrusted Bowie to the cat. Like any other interaction, it was hard to imagine what this was going to be like. To the great joy of Shelbi and her associates, Dottie was very concerned and immediately welcomed Bowie into her little tribe. Shelbi testified: “She immediately became attached to him. She treats him as if he were her baby, who arrived a little later. Bowie was always glued to her. He wanted a mother . ”

 

Thanks to Dottie ‘s love , Bowie was able to quickly get back on track. He integrated into the family, without jealousy or competition, and grew at his own pace, which allowed him to return to a normal weight. 

 

Before being put up for adoption, Bowie was able to take full advantage of the kindness of his adoptive mother. Dottie , decisive in the kitten’s life story, will have contributed to its development, both physical and psychological.
